In 2019-2020, 1,422 people earned their degree in elementary special education, making the major the 367th most popular in the United States.

Across the Southeast region, there were 10 elementary special education gra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 8 elementary special education gra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,277 and $25,415 respectively.

Shorter University

Rome, Georgia
#2 in overall quality

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Elementary Special Ed Schools for a Bachelor’s in the Southeast Region For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, Shorter University landed the #1 spot on the list. Shorter is a small school located in Rome, Georgia that handed out 5 bachelors’s elementary special ed degrees in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at Shorter,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Elementary Special Education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Southeast Region”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Shorter University is $20,646 for southeast region bachelor’s degree elementary special ed students whose families make $48-$75k.

William Peace University

Raleigh, North Carolina
#1 in overall quality

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Elementary Special Ed Schools for a Bachelor’s in the Southeast Region For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, William Peace University landed the #2 spot on the list. WPU is a private not-for-profit institution located in Raleigh, North Carolina. The school has a small population, and it awarded 3 bachelors’s degrees in 2019-2020.

WPU did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Elementary Special Education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Southeast Region” list. The estimated yearly cost for WPU is $21,075 for Southeast Region Bachelor’s Degree Elementary Special Ed students whose families make $48-$75k.
